There is or was an ice rink in Hagerstown. Don't know if it is still open or if it has any freestyle or public sessions. Here is a link

http://www.hagerstownice.org/freestyle.php


About 8 miles east of Leesburg VA in Ashburn is the Ashburn Ice House. They have lots of freestyle and dance sessions. www.ashburnice.com

Also about another 8 miles east of where Ashburn ice House is, is Skatequest Reston (www.skatequest.com). M-F all day freestyle (6AM-5:50pm). And in Fairfax there's the Fairfax Ice Arena (www.fairfaxicearena.com)

You know about Skate Frederick in Frederick MD.
